Once you have posted a thread to complain about not being able to post a clickable link, the problem is moot. There are two ways around it - the first os to prove you are a human being and not a bot by posting something like a hello, the second is to use all your l33t hax0r knowledge and post a non-clickable link h tt://www.example.com for example.
With the traffic we receive, allowing spambots an easy ride would mean that this forum would become unusable in very little time. We're trading a small bit of convenience to allow usability. Fair trade off? |

Between the no url rule and having spam catchers in the background we get very very few spams. All our spam tends to be from human beings rather than bots and gets caught in minutes - the "many eyes making all bugs shallow" thing in action! We've all seen promising sites sink under the wealth of spam that hits anywhere they can and we really really don't want that to happen to LQ.
